Divorce

Divorce is the legal dissolution of a marriage. Family law attorneys can guide clients through the divorce process, ensuring their rights and interests are protected. They provide advice on legal grounds for divorce, division of marital assets and debts, alimony, and child custody arrangements.

Child Custody

Child custody disputes can be highly contentious. Attorneys can represent clients in child custody proceedings, advocating for their best interests and ensuring fair outcomes. They can help establish legal agreements that Artikel parenting plans, visitation schedules, and decision-making responsibilities.

Child Support

Child support is a legal obligation for parents to financially provide for their children. Family law attorneys can assist clients in establishing, modifying, or enforcing child support orders. They can calculate support amounts based on state guidelines and represent clients in court proceedings.

Spousal Support

Spousal support, also known as alimony, is financial assistance provided by one spouse to another after a divorce. Attorneys can negotiate and draft spousal support agreements that consider factors such as income disparity, earning capacity, and the duration of the marriage.

Estate Planning

Estate planning involves creating legal documents that Artikel how an individual’s assets will be distributed after their death. Family law attorneys can draft wills, trusts, and other estate planning documents that protect clients’ wishes and ensure their assets are distributed according to their intentions.

Prenuptial Agreements

Prenuptial agreements are legal contracts entered into before marriage that establish the rights and responsibilities of each spouse in the event of a divorce. Family law attorneys can draft and review prenuptial agreements, ensuring that they are fair and legally enforceable.

Understanding legal fees and payment options is crucial when hiring a family law attorney in Jacksonville, NC. Attorneys employ various fee structures and payment plans to accommodate clients’ financial situations.

Factors influencing attorney fees include case complexity, the experience of the attorney, and the time and effort required to resolve the matter. Attorneys may charge an hourly rate, a flat fee for specific services, or a contingency fee based on the outcome of the case.

Payment Options

Clients have several payment options available to them. Payment plans allow clients to spread out the cost of legal services over time, making them more manageable. Contingency fees, on the other hand, involve the attorney receiving a percentage of any settlement or award obtained in the case. However, contingency fees are not always available in family law matters.

Government Agencies

  • Clerk of Court, Onslow County: Provides access to court records, filing fees, and general information related to family law proceedings.
  • Onslow County Department of Social Services: Offers a range of services, including child protective services, adoption assistance, and support for families in need.

Legal Aid Organizations

  • Legal Aid of North Carolina: Provides free or low-cost legal assistance to low-income individuals and families facing family law issues.
  • Coastal Carolina Legal Services: Offers legal representation and advocacy for victims of domestic violence, child abuse, and other family-related legal matters.

Online Resources

  • North Carolina Bar Association Family Law Section: Provides a directory of family law attorneys, educational materials, and updates on family law legislation.
  • American Bar Association Family Law Section: Offers a wealth of information on family law topics, including articles, webinars, and resources for professionals.
